A gamepad Bluetooth is a wireless controller that connects to gaming consoles or PCs via Bluetooth technology, allowing for a seamless gaming experience without the hassle of wires.

When choosing a gamepad Bluetooth, consider the following features to enhance your gaming experience:
  • Compatibility: Ensure the gamepad is compatible with your console or PC.
  • Battery Life: Look for controllers with long battery life to minimize interruptions during gameplay.
  • Ergonomics: A comfortable grip and layout can significantly improve your gaming sessions.
  • Feedback: Vibration feedback enhances immersion, making gameplay more engaging.
